Luton is north of London on the M1 corridor — a budget-carrier airport hosting easyJet's primary base plus Wizz Air, Ryanair, and TUI. For Southampton travellers it's the third or fourth London airport choice for cost-conscious flights to Europe.

What makes Luton different

Two things.

Physical barrier + card payment exit, not ANPR. Most UK airports use ANPR cameras to read the driver's plate and post-bill. Luton still operates a physical barrier at the drop-off / pickup exit, with card payment to lift it. This means slightly longer driver exit times on busy mornings — we factor this into pickup-time calculations.

Drop-off surcharge: £7 for 10 minutes; £1 per minute beyond. The driver completes the drop fast — usually under 5 minutes — so this is well within the included time.

Pickup-at-terminal IS allowed at Luton (unusual for the major London airports). The driver can wait briefly at the kerbside meet-point holding a name board, rather than parking in short-stay.

When Luton wins

For Southampton travellers:

  • Wizz Air routes that don't exist at Gatwick — Eastern European destinations (Sofia, Tirana, Wroclaw, Bratislava).
  • easyJet routes where the Luton schedule fits better than Gatwick.
  • Ryanair when Stansted is the alternative. Luton's £170 chauffeur beats Stansted's £220 for routes available from both.

When to skip Luton

  • Major destination served from Gatwick or Heathrow at similar fare: drive's shorter and surcharges similar.
  • Long-haul flight: Luton has very limited long-haul. Heathrow's the call.
